Part Overview

The TE Connectivity AMP Connectors 696434-1 is an insulated ring terminal connector designed for 4 AWG wire gauge applications with a D-shaped stud configuration and #10 stud size. This component is part of the Plasti-Grip series and features crimp termination with tin-plated copper contact material. The 696434-1 is classified as obsolete, necessitating identification of active equivalent alternatives to maintain design continuity and ensure supply chain availability for new production and repair applications.

Engineering Selection Recommendations

The 696434-1 is classified as obsolete, making the active substitute part 54748-1 the appropriate selection for ongoing production and maintenance applications. Both components maintain ROHS3 compliance and identical electrical specifications for 4 AWG wire gauge applications.

The primary difference between these components is the terminal geometry: the 696434-1 features a D-shaped terminal with #10 stud size, while the 54748-1 provides a circular terminal with 1/4 stud size. This geometric variation does not affect electrical performance or current-carrying capacity, as both maintain identical wire gauge, contact material, contact finish, and insulation specifications.

Selection of 54748-1 as a substitute is appropriate when the application accommodates circular terminal geometry and 1/4 stud connection points. The substitute part's active product status ensures continued availability and supply chain support compared to the obsolete 696434-1.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Can the 54748-1 directly replace the 696434-1 in all applications?

A: The 54748-1 provides electrical and material equivalence to the 696434-1 for 4 AWG wire gauge applications. However, the terminal geometry differs: 54748-1 features a circular terminal with 1/4 stud size, while 696434-1 features a D-shaped terminal with #10 stud size. Substitution is valid when the application accommodates these geometric differences and the connection point accepts a 1/4 stud configuration.

Q: What are the critical parameters that must match between the main part and substitute?

A: Wire gauge (4 AWG), termination method (crimp), contact material (copper with tin finish), insulation material (PVC), mounting configuration (free hanging, right angle), and compliance certifications (ROHS3) must remain identical. These parameters ensure electrical performance, mechanical durability, and regulatory compliance.

Q: Why is the 696434-1 obsolete and what does this mean for procurement?

A: Obsolete status indicates the 696434-1 is no longer in active production. The 54748-1 is the active equivalent part available from TE Connectivity AMP Connectors. For new designs and ongoing production, the 54748-1 should be specified to ensure supply chain continuity and manufacturer support.

Q: Are there packaging differences between these parts?

A: The 696434-1 packaging information is not specified in available data. The 54748-1 is supplied in bulk packaging. Packaging configuration should be confirmed with the supplier based on specific procurement requirements.

Q: Do both parts meet the same regulatory and compliance standards?

A: Yes. Both the 696434-1 and 54748-1 are ROHS3 compliant and carry identical MSL (Moisture Sensitivity Level) ratings of 1 (Unlimited). Both are classified under ECCN EAR99 and HTSUS 8536.90.4000.

Q: What is the difference between D-shaped and circular terminal types?

A: Terminal type refers to the geometry of the ring connector. D-shaped terminals provide a specific contact profile, while circular terminals provide a round contact profile. Both accommodate the same wire gauge and provide equivalent electrical performance. Selection depends on the mating connector or stud configuration in the application.

Q: How do stud sizes #10 and 1/4 differ?

A: Stud size refers to the diameter of the connection point. #10 stud and 1/4 stud are different nominal sizes. The 1/4 stud (0.250") is larger than the #10 stud. Substitution is valid only when the application's mating connector or terminal block accommodates the 1/4 stud size.
